A video has emerged showing the moment #EndSARS protesters in Oshodi area of Lagos, “disgraced” Bola Tinubu, the National Leader of the All Progressives Congress (APC), Nigeria’s ruling party.

Naija News reports that protesting youths in Nigeria are agitating for the end to police brutalization and extrajudicial killings of Nigerians. The protesters have been on the streets for more than a week now, protesting the brutalities, humiliation, and extortion of Nigerians, especially the youths.

The protesters demanded an end to the Special Anti-Robbery Squad (SARS), a police unit under the Force Criminal Investigation and Intelligence Department headed by the Deputy Inspector General of Police Anthony Ogbizi, using a hashtag: #EndSARS.

On Sunday, October 11, 2020, the Inspector General of Police (IGP) Mohammed Adamu disbanded SARS following a widespread protest from Nigerians worldwide.

However, since the announcement that SARS has been scrapped, the protesters have refused to leave the streets, which a Presidential Advisory Committee says might force the Federal Government to take drastic measures against the protesting youths.

On Monday, October 19, #EndSARS protesters protesting in Oshodi were heard chanting “Tinubu Ole” in Yoruba which translates to “Tinubu thief”, a situation which can best be described as an embarrassment to Tinubu, a two-time former governor of Lagos State, Nigeria’s commercial city.
